Natalie Rasmussen has escaped with a fine despite betting against her own drive in the New Zealand Trotting Cup. (she did not escape a fine as noted below)

Rasmussen, who trains in partnership with Mark Purdon, backed Smolda to win the Group I cup in a futures market but she drove his All Stars stablemate Messini.

Rasmussen admitted three betting related charges brought against her by the Racing Integrity Unit (RIU) at a Judicial Control Authority (JCA) hearing.

The RIU accepted that at the time she placed the bet on Smolda she was injured and did not expect to drive in the Trotting Cup.

In addition to the punt on Smolda, she also faced a charge of backing her own drive, Chase The Dream to win the Sires Stakes final.


 
Drivers are not allowed to bet in races they are competing in. Rasmussen said she was not aware of the rule because she did not usually bet.

Rasmussen has been fined $3750 and ordered to pay costs of $350 to the the JCA after being cleared of any intent to deceive or commit a sinister act.

In relation to the first two charges which relate to a $200 bet on Smolda in the futures market at $4.00 on which was placed on October 23, Rasmussen said she thought she was no chance of driving on cup day when she placed the bet.

It depends on the circumstances of this bet.  If they had been intentionally not winning for several races and all of a sudden were on "go" and bet, then I have a lot of problem with that.  Additionally, pools at many tracks are so small that even a $20 win may have some impact, let alone hundreds of dollars.
